This is a tech demo, guys. It has like 2x the memory and plenty more horsepower to spend on looking good than an actual game does, since it doesn't need to have all the other overhead.  Comparing it to CoD or KZ2 is kind of misleading.

Nonetheless, it does look awesome. I noticed they were tending to show off shadows and lighting on the PS3, and general texture/shader work on the X360. Very typical, from released games as evidence, as a difference in the things the two consoles typically excel at.
